The 2025 Can-Am Ryker 900 ACE dominates the three-wheeler market with 65% of Ryker sales, moving over 16,700 units in 2024—a 15.2% year-over-year increase. Its $9,899 starting price (after $750 rebate), Rotax 900 ACE engine delivering 82 hp, and urban-friendly dimensions (92.6" L x 59.9" W) make it the top choice for eco-conscious commuters seeking affordability without compromising performance123.
Market Performance and Sales Trends
BRP's strategic focus on urban mobility has propelled Ryker sales growth for three consecutive years. The 900 ACE variant drives this momentum through its optimal balance of power and efficiency, capturing the largest segment of first-time three-wheeler buyers according to dealer network data23.
| Model Variant | Starting Price | Engine | Market Share | Key Differentiators |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Ryker 900 ACE | $9,899 | Rotax 900 ACE (82 hp) | 65% | CVT transmission, Bosch ABS, UFit adjustable seating |
| Ryker 500 | $7,999 | Rotax 500 (45 hp) | 25% | Entry-level, simplified controls, lighter weight |
| Ryker Rally | $10,499 | Rotax 900 ACE (82 hp) | 10% | Off-road tires, raised suspension, adventure styling |
The Ryker 900 ACE's market leadership stems from its strategic positioning between entry-level and premium models. Its 65% market share reflects strong demand for the optimal power-to-price ratio, while the Rally variant's 10% share indicates growing interest in adventure-oriented three-wheelers23.
Key Drivers of Consumer Demand
Three factors consistently drive purchase decisions according to dealer surveys and BRP's market analysis:
- Pricing Strategy: The $9,899 entry point (after $750 rebate) creates accessibility while maintaining premium positioning. This pricing sweet spot captures buyers upgrading from entry-level models and those seeking more power than the $7,999 Ryker 500 offers13.
- Fuel Efficiency: The Rotax 900 ACE engine delivers 55 MPG in urban cycles—15% better than 2023 models—making it the most economical three-wheeler in its class for daily commuters3.
- Ergonomic Innovation: The UFit system with adjustable footpegs and handlebars accommodates 95% of rider heights (5'0" to 6'5"), eliminating fitment concerns that previously deterred potential buyers23.
